Transaction 90706845d24ff429184af5ca0ba5427c003cd918708c2128fab7cf6bc9aff2d0

1 Input
2 Outputs
  • 90706845d24ff429184af5ca0ba5427c003cd918708c2128fab7cf6bc9aff2d0:0
  • value  50000000
    address  3KfKFeopYB156gUzzcit75w7yAm7tsh9TE
  • 90706845d24ff429184af5ca0ba5427c003cd918708c2128fab7cf6bc9aff2d0:1
  • value  148218640
    address  1LTeEjS5KUCDj9NWdnmrSLummudVkFmxbs